Least Common Multiple of 95839 and 95853 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 95839 and 95853,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(95839,95853) = 1
LCM(95839,95853) = ( 95839 × 95853) / 1
LCM(95839,95853) = 9186455667 / 1
LCM(95839,95853) = 9186455667
